We use cookies and other technologies on this website to enhance your user experience.
By clicking any link on this page you are giving your consent to our Privacy Policy and Cookies Policy.

關於NetSimple

網絡發送位置信息到微控制器的遠程控制。

該應用的目的是控制像Arduino的,Netduino,樹莓派遠程硬件...

該協議是TCP / IP(客戶端)。

UP:0,功率,0

DOWN:0 - 功率,0

LEFT: - 電源,功率,0

RIGHT:功率,功率,0

MIDDLE:0,0,0或0,0,功率(零活性)

字節模式:3位置轉移為3個字節(默認)

ASCII模式:3位置轉移由逗號分隔文本(由\ n結束)

會話不活動:在Serated連接每個傳輸

會議積極:連接永遠不會關閉,但如果需要自動重新連接(缺省)

零停滯:沒有回歸到零值後釋放

零激活:自動恢復發行後零值

對樹莓派的服務器示例代碼:

的#include“stdio.h中”

#包括“stdlib.h中”

的#include“string.h中”

#包括“unistd.h中”

#包括“SYS / types.h中”

#包括“SYS / socket.h中”

#包括“netinet / in.h中”

無效錯誤(為const char * MSG)

{

    PERROR(MSG);

    出口(1);

}

INT主(INT ARGC,CHAR *的argv [])

{

    INT的sockfd,newsockfd,PORTNO,N;

    socklen_t的clilen;

    字符緩衝區[256];

    結構SOCKADDR_IN serv_addr,cli_addr;

    的sockfd =插座(AF_INET,SOCK_STREAM,0);

    如果(的sockfd <0)

         錯誤(“錯誤打開插座”);

    bzero((字符*)serv_addr,sizeof的(serv_addr));

    PORTNO = 12345;

    serv_addr.sin_family = AF_INET;

    serv_addr.sin_addr.s_addr = INADDR_ANY;

    serv_addr.sin_port = htons(PORTNO);

    如果(綁定(的sockfd,(結構sockaddr *)

           &Serv_addr,sizeof的(serv_addr))<0)

                錯誤(“綁定錯誤”);

    而(1)

    {

         聽(的sockfd,5);

         clilen = sizeof的(cli_addr);

         newsockfd =接受(的sockfd,(結構sockaddr *)

               &Cli_addr,與clilen);

         如果(newsockfd <0)

               錯誤(“ERROR在接受”);

         而(1)

         {

               bzero(緩衝液,256);

               N =讀(newsockfd,緩衝液,3);

               如果(N <3)

               {

                     錯誤(“ERROR從套接字讀取”);

                     突破;

               }

               浮TMP1 =(浮點)緩衝器[0];

               如果(TMP1> 127)

                     TMP1 - = 256;

               浮TMP2 =(浮點)緩衝器[1];

               如果(TMP2> 127)

                      TMP2 - = 256;

               浮動TMP3 =(浮點)緩衝[2];

               如果(TMP3> 127)

                      TMP3 - = 256;

               的printf(“%d個%D \ n”,(INT)TMP1,(INT)TMP2,(INT)TMP3);

         }

         關閉(newsockfd);

     }

     接近(的sockfd);

     返回0;

}

最新版本1.0更新日誌

Last updated on 2016年07月08日

Minor bug fixes and improvements. Install or update to the newest version to check it out!

翻譯中...

更多應用信息

最新版本

請求 NetSimple 更新 1.0

上傳者

Hilmi Dogan

系統要求

Android 2.2+

Available on

NetSimple 來源 Google Play

更多

NetSimple 螢幕截圖

訂閱APKPure
第一時間獲取熱門安卓遊戲應用的首發體驗,最新資訊和玩法教程。
不,謝謝
訂閱
訂閱成功!
您已訂閱APKPure。
訂閱APKPure
第一時間獲取熱門安卓遊戲應用的首發體驗,最新資訊和玩法教程。
不,謝謝
訂閱
成功!
您已訂閱我們的郵件通知。